US markets today: Wall Street drifts lower into quieter close; tariff walk-backs cap volatility

US stocks edged lower on Friday, concluding a turbulent week marked by tariff threats and reversals. Investors adopted a cautious stance amid limited clarity on trade and geopolitical signals. Markets were on track to end a second straight week with modest losses after sharp swings earlier in the week.
